Explore the Mystical Serpent Mound: An Ancient Wonder

Uncover the ancient mysteries of Serpent Mound, a historical landmark showcasing the ingenuity of Indigenous cultures in Ohio.

Serpent Mound is an extraordinary historical landmark located in the heart of Ohio, drawing visitors with its unique, serpentine shape that stretches over 1,348 feet. This ancient effigy mound is believed to have been constructed by Indigenous peoples, possibly the Adena or Fort Ancient cultures, over a millennium ago. The site is not only a testament to the remarkable engineering skills of its builders but also holds deep cultural and spiritual significance. As you explore the area, you'll be greeted by lush greenery, offering a serene backdrop that enhances the site's enigmatic atmosphere. The mound itself is an impressive structure, resembling a serpent with an undulating body and a coiled tail, which many believe aligns with celestial events, suggesting a sophisticated understanding of astronomy among its creators. Visitors can walk along designated paths that provide stunning views of the mound and its surrounding landscape, making it a perfect spot for photography enthusiasts. The site also features a small museum that delves into the history and significance of the mound, providing context and enriching your visit. Facilities at Serpent Mound include well-maintained bathrooms and a picnic pavilion, making it convenient for families and groups to spend an entire day soaking in the history and natural beauty. Whether you are a history buff, nature lover, or simply seeking a unique experience, Serpent Mound offers a captivating glimpse into the past, inviting you to ponder the mysteries of this ancient site and the people who once inhabited this land.
